时序逻辑电路分析:从方程到状态图

需积分: 25 0 下载量 109 浏览量 更新于2024-08-17 收藏 514KB PPT 举报
"时序逻辑电路的分析方法和示例" 在时序逻辑电路中,电路的输出状态不仅取决于当前的输入信号,还与电路的原始状态相关,这是其核心特征。这种电路通常包含记忆元件,如触发器,以及反馈通道,使得电路能够记住之前的信号状态。时序逻辑电路的分析通常包括以下几个步骤: 1. **时钟方程**:首先,确定电路中的时钟信号,这对于同步时序逻辑电路尤其重要,因为它决定了何时更新电路状态。 2. **输出方程**:分析逻辑图,写出所有触发器的输出方程,这些方程描述了输出如何依赖于输入和当前状态。 3. **驱动方程**:确定每个触发器的驱动方程,这些方程描述了触发器状态的变化如何受输入和当前状态影响。 4. **状态方程**:将驱动方程代入触发器的特性方程,求得时序逻辑电路的状态方程。这一步帮助我们理解电路如何从一个状态转移到另一个状态。 5. **状态表和状态图**:根据状态方程和输出方程,列出状态表并绘制状态图。状态图是显示电路所有可能状态及其转换关系的图形表示。 6. **逻辑功能的解释**:最后,通过状态表和状态图来解释和描述给定时序逻辑电路的具体逻辑功能。 以同步时序逻辑电路为例,分析通常会更加简化,因为所有触发器的翻转都是在时钟脉冲的上升沿同时进行的,所以时钟方程通常是明确的,无需单独写出。例如,在给出的电路分析中,电路的输出方程和驱动方程被列出,接着用于求解状态方程。通过解决这些方程并绘制状态图,可以理解电路的行为。 在示例6.2.1中,当X=0或X=1时,电路的触发器次态方程和输出方程被简化,并据此制作了状态转换表和状态图。这揭示了电路如何根据输入X和当前状态Q的变化来改变其输出Z。 总结来说,时序逻辑电路的分析是一个系统化的过程,涉及逻辑方程的建立、状态转换的计算以及功能的描述。这种分析对于理解和设计复杂的数字系统至关重要,例如计数器、寄存器和更复杂的微处理器等。